"Identification." Said the stern guard, Ryuu pulled out his ID and the guard took and inspected it. He quickly handed it back and lowered a part of the wall.
Inside is the 'Soul Cultivation Academy' its a grand structure created by Don Hanzo himself.
Its square shaped with a 4×4 mile courtyard in the middle with platforms for sparing.
Every new semester they have the placement exam, it’s to see a persons element control and understanding of it. Then depending on what year they're in They’re assigned to their teacher.
Ryuu woke up early today to skip all the waiting, so when he entered the courtyard there was mostly only teachers with a couple of students who were all just chatting amongst themselves.
When they saw Ryuu a few stopped to greet him, after all this was his 4th and final year at the academy and was one of the most promising students. With no family background or support he was always just a little behind in his cultivation, he was an extremely hard worker.
As he walked through the courtyard he heard people whispering. “Did you hear that last semester he wasn’t able to advance at all and got stuck in 5 Face Waxing Moon.” A voice whispered.
As he walked the whispering continued.
After a few casual greetings he finally reached the table where the academy’s head master Kioshi and two high level teachers, master Daiki and master Katsumi were sitting. He cupped his hands and lightly bowed as he said "Morning head master and senior masters, I was hoping you would please allow me to take my placement exam early?"
A beautiful blonde slowly looked up and said "There’s no better time then the present, since you’re so eager lets see what you can do."
Ryuu decided it would be best to not show that he had broken through to sun realm.

Ryuu walked up to the side table and grabbed the moon stone and then started to inject his qi energy, the whole corner of the courtyard grew silent as all the teachers and students watched.
The stone went from white to pitch black, all the teachers where shocked upon seeing this.
Then the stone glowed ruby red as it got darker and darker until it was a dark burgundy, then before it started to crack Ryuu placed the stone back on the table.
Everyone was speechless, as they all just starred in disbelief.
The next test was to test your control of your element(s). Ryuu first built up his qi energy mobilizing it in his soul then he concentrated it all in a ball in his chest.
Then simultaneously he ignited the cendrillion in his right hand and compressed it to a ball with his left. He then tossed the ball of black flames into the air and then took a deep breath and exhaled a surge of powerful wind.
Together they created a powerful fire breath attack that was so intense it made the temperature rise, as even the morning frost on the grass evaporated.
All the students and teachers including the head master were speechless.
Seeing everyone’s reaction Ryuu decided to conceal the rest of his strength and left it at that for now, he already showed sufficient strength to be put in a elite class.
For it was rare for someone to have such a strong control over his qi, and he was able to perfectly combine multiple elements at once, not to mention he’s still just a young man. Who knows how strong he might become in the future.
The head master and the other two huddled together in private. Then after a few minutes looked up and Kioshi said “After discussing we have decided to put you in master Yuri’s class."

All the students starred enviously at Ryuu.
Even Ryuu was speechless, master Yuri is an old sage of the Platinum Sun realm he’s renowned for his techniques and battle strategies. He only accepts the best and most promising students and only takes 10 new disciples a ssemester!
Ryuu walked up got his letter of recommendation cupped his hands as he said "Many thanks to my senior masters, I'll take my leave now."
“Don’t thank us yet, master Yuri still has final say, so make sure you leave a good first impression." Said master Daiki.
"Of course." said Ryuu as he hurried off towards Master Yuri's.
Yuri's class is not part of the main building but was behind the academy on a cliff side.
As Ryuu approached the face the cliff he felt a surge of killing intent, then six shadow strands flew out like arrows and tried to screwier him.
He jumped back a few feet then activated the qi in his soul realm, just then a black kunai materialized in his hand. He then chucked the kunai at the face of the cliff, as the kunai flew through the air the inscriptions emitted a dazzling metallic light.
Using just one finger Ryuu guided the kunai through each shadow and pinned all six strands to the cliff side.
The attacker gasped as he starred in disbelief, this new comer had fully countered his attack with out breaking a sweat and had fully suppressed his shadow spears.
Hearing the noise from the left behind some rocks, Ryuu activated his qi and pulled the kunai and all six shadows out of the wall. Using the kunai as a conductor he enhanced the power of the shadows and sent them smashing through the rocks toward the attacker.
A loud shriek came from inside the smoke cloud, then two men leaped from the smoke and landed on either side of Ryuu, one was badly injured on his right leg but managed to stay standing.
As Ryuu mobilized his qi and was about to summon the second kunai, he heard light clapping from the top of the cliff.
As a stern rasp voice said "That’s enough, go get yourself patched up. You, what’s your name?"
As the voice spoke both men immediately stood up straight with there arms at their sides, as they stood at attention.
